About the Role
Join our team at Sunriver Resort, voted Top 100 Businesses to Work for in Oregon! The Food & Beverage Administrative Assistant provides administrative support to all resort Food & Beverage outlets and acts as a liaison between Human Resources and F&B team members. This role supports the AAA Four Diamond Standards and upholds Sunriver Resort’s Core Values: Trust, Open & Honest Communication, and Commitment. You will exemplify the Sunriver Resort Culture and help deliver exceptional service to all internal and external guests.
Responsibilities
- Provides general administrative support to Food & Beverage and Culinary Management
- Answers phone calls for the Lodge outlets when host/MOD is not available
- Books and contracts bands and musicians for performances throughout the Lodge Outlets, including The Backyard and the Owl’s Nest
- Works with group contacts and clients to book and contract special events, including Private Room Dining
- Communicates with Sales and Conventions teams to ensure successful execution of group events in Lodge Food & Beverage spaces
- Attends weekly resume (groups in house) meeting in person or via Teams
- Ensures group bookings are updated in Delphi, 7Shifts, RESY, and F&B Calendar
- Organizes and updates group event menus
- Reviews final billing for group events and edits if necessary
- Creates Purchase Orders and Check Requests through Birchstreet, including Expense Reports
- Processes payroll and monitors time corrections for all Lodge Food & Beverage Outlets in UKG
- Ensures departmental compliance with Predictive Schedule
- Monitors and ensures proper compliance with tip claiming sheets and minor break logs
- Keeps current and accurate associate manual time sheets for all associates
- Picks up paychecks, manages distribution, and returns signed documents to payroll
- Ensures accurate statuses and updates forms for associates with multiple job codes
- Attends bi-monthly team meetings
- Maintains OLCC and Food Handlers compliance for F&B associates
- Orders office supplies
- Assists manager with associate onboarding/departure paperwork
- Reports any needed repairs via SMS work order
- Organizes the Meadow’s folder on the “V” drive
- Communicates all pertinent information to the outlet teams
- Maintains a professional demeanor and appearance, adhering to Sunriver Resort dress code standards
- Remains alert, courteous, and helpful to guests and colleagues at all times
- Performs other related duties as assigned
